These are the faucet issues we see most often across Earl, NC.
A steady drip is almost always a worn cartridge, washer, or O-ring — replaced with the correct part for your specific brand.
We test the full range of motion after replacement to confirm smooth operation.
We can install a faucet you've purchased or help recommend one that fits your existing setup.
Reduced flow at a single faucet is often a clogged aerator or a failing cartridge, not a whole-house pressure issue.
A leaking or frozen-damaged outdoor spigot gets repaired or replaced, often with a frost-proof upgrade recommended.
We clean or replace aerators as part of a full faucet service visit.
